Across TCGA patient cohorts, TBX19 RNA expression is significantly associated with the protein abundance of many other proteins, with 14,454 significant associations in total. BRCA shows the largest number of these associations.

The most reproducible TBX19-associated proteins across cancer lineages are GATAD2B, TIPRL, and PARP1. Each is linked with TBX19 in more than 5 cancer types. Because this analysis shows association rather than direction, both TBX19-to-partner and partner-to-TBX19 results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, TBX19 versus GATAD2B in PDAC, with a Pearson correlation of 0.46.
